We are proud to welcome Hrvoje Sivrić as a keynote speaker at the 4th International Scientific Conference – 4 Healthy Academic Society (4HAS), taking place from May 27–28, 2026, in Poreč.
Expert in sports management, education, and academic sport development
Dr. Sivrić is an Assistant Professor at the University of Slavonski Brod, where his work focuses on the development of sport within academic and educational environments.
His expertise connects sport, education, and management, with a strong emphasis on:
✅ Sports management and sports economics
✅ Development of academic sport systems
✅ Kinesiology education and methodology
✅ Student engagement through sport and physical activity
✅ Implementation of sport programs across different age groups
From education to implementation: building stronger academic sport systems
With a career spanning teaching, institutional leadership, and applied research, Dr. Sivrić brings a practical perspective on how sport can be integrated into educational institutions to improve student experience and wellbeing.
He has played an active role in shaping sport and education through leadership positions, including his work within the Croatian Academic Sports Federation, where he contributes to the development and funding of sport initiatives at the national level.
His involvement in EU-funded and applied research projects further highlights his commitment to connecting academia with real-world challenges, including sport, tourism, and sustainable development.
